`
fulerbakesi
  • 浏览: 564222 次
文章分类
社区版块
存档分类
最新评论

JDBC连接数据库过程

 
阅读更多

使用JDBC连接数据库的步骤如下:

(1)首先要在应用程序中加载JDBC驱动程序.通常使用Class.forName()方法加载,需要注意的一点就是要设好类路径classpath,确保JDBC驱动在类路径中.

Oracle数据库驱动程序的加载方法:

Class.forName("Oracle.jdbc.driver.OracleDriver");

DB2数据库驱动程序的加载方法:

Class.forName("com.ibm.db2.jdbc.app.DB2Driver");

SQL server 200数据库驱动程序的加载方法:

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Drvier");

Sybase数据库驱动程序的加载方法:

Class.forName("com.sybase.jdbc.SybDrvier");

MySQL数据库驱动程序的加载方法:

Class.forName("org.gjt.mm.mysql.Driver");

(2)成功加载JDBC驱动程序后,负责管理JDBC驱动程序的类DriverManager会识别加载的驱动程序.于是DriverManager就调用方法getConnection()来连接数据库:

与Oracle数据库建立连接的方法:

String url="jdbc:oracle:thin:@localhost?1512:orcl";//orcl为数据库的SID

String user="test";

String password="test";

Connection con=DriverManager.getConnection(url,user,password);

与DB2数据库建立连接的方法:

String url="jdbc:db2://localhost:5000/sample";//sample为数据库名

String user="admin";

String password="";

Connction con=DriverManager.getConnection(url,user,password);

与SQL Server2000数据库建立连接的方法

String url="j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=mydb";//mydb为数据库名

String user="sa";

String password="";

Connection conn=DriverManager.getConnection(url,user,password);

与MySQL数据库建立连接的方法:

String url="jdbc:mysql://localhost/myDD";//myDB为数据库名

String user="root";

String password="admin";

Connection conn=DriverManager.getConnection(url,user,password);

(3)获取Connection对象以后,可以用Connection对象的方法来创建一个Statement对象的实例.来对数据库进行操作:举例:

//con为一个Connection对像的实例.用con的方法来创建一个Statement对像的实例

Statement stmt=con.createStatement();

//执行了SQL语句生成了一个名为Studentr的表

String query="select * from student";

ResuletSet result=stmt.executeQuery(query);

分享到:
评论

相关推荐

    JDBC连接数据库步骤

    jdbc java 数据库 连接数据库 步骤

    数据库实验JDBC连接数据库.docx

    选课序号:36 选课序号:36 大连海事大学 数据库原理课程实验报告 (2010-2011学年第二学期) 实验八 JDBC连接数据库 班 级: 智能一班 学 号: ********** 姓 名: 徐维坚 指导教师: *** 成 绩: 2012年 6月 13日 ...

    JDBC连接数据库BaseDao通用类(可以调用存储过程)

    JDBC连接数据库BaseDao通用类(可以调用存储过程)

    实验3 JDBC操作数据库3

    如下图所示1、通过常规JDBC访问数据库目的:练习JDBC连接、操作数据库的完整过程(所有操作写在同一个类文件中即可)注意命名规范,建议:1)项目名全部小写,例

    JDBC连接数据库实例+附源码

    目的:使用JDBC连接MySQL数据库并且完成增删改查。 介绍:1)一种执行SQL语言的Java API。  2)可以对所以主流数据库进行统一访问(access,MySQL,sql server,Oracle)。  3)极大地减少了程序操作数据库的复杂...

    jdbc连接oracle,执行存储过程,带数据库存储过程

    jdbc连接oracle,执行存储过程,带数据库存储过程,代码是详细的源码,读取配置文件,连接jdbc,执行存储过程。

    JDBC连接Access数据库

    JDBC连接Access数据库的详细过程及代码

    JDBC数据库编程实验

    (1)熟练掌握JDBC操作数据库的整个过程; (2)利用预处理语句操作数据库; (3)掌握可滚动和可更新的结果集的基本操作方法; (4)理解JDBC中实现事务处理的基本方法; (5)理解数据库连接池的基本原理和思想,...

    JDBC连接SQL server数据库详细全过程

    详细介绍了,使用JDBC连接SQLserver数据库的全过程,各种配置各种步骤都非常详细。 仔细看一遍,很容易上手入门。 网上JDBC的教程很多,但是都很杂,很容易出错,这个里面讲解非常好。

    jdbc连接数据库的方式2

    二、JDBC连接MySql方式 下面是使用JDBC连接MySql的一个小的教程 1、查找驱动程序 MySQL目前提供的java驱动程序为Connection/J,可以从MySQL官方网站下载,并找到mysql-connector-java-3.0.15-ga-bin.jar文件,此...

    Java程序通过JDBC连接SQLServer2000数据库全解.doc

    此doc文档详细介绍了Java程序通过JDBC连接SQLServer2000数据库的全过程和连接代码

    JDBC连接MySQL

    Eclipse利用JDBC连接MySQL数据库,附带MySQL的JDBC驱动,和过程教程

    JDBC连接所有数据库步骤

    JDBC连接所有数据库步骤 1 将数据库的JDBC驱动加载到classpath中,在基于JAVAEE的WEB应用实际开发过程中,通常要把目标数据库产品的JDBC驱动复制到WEB-INF/lib下. 2 加载JDBC驱动,并将其注册到DriverManager中。 3...

    java和jdbc用数据库连接的swing界面

    jdbc s数据库 swing 简单过程

    jdbc连接数据库进行带参数更新操作

    1、连接数据库的过程步骤2、完成增删改查案例3、具体案例代码分析

    Java与JDBC驱动连接并查询数据库.rar

    Java与JDBC驱动连接并查询数据库,Java 需要通过JDBC 对数据库进行查询,以完成对信息的收集、分类和展示的功能。在JDBC 中对数据库的查询有一般查询、参数查询和存储过程这样三类。本例在此实现这三种查询方法。...

    JDBC 3.0数据库开发与设计

    2.2 使用JDBC连接数据库 2.2.1 SQLJ基本知识 2.2.2 用PL/SQL和Java建立应用程序的基本知识 2.2.3 PL/SQL和Java的特性 2.2.4 PL/SQL和Java的实际开发应用实例 2.2.5 Java连接各类数据库的程序代码 2.3 Web应用...

    JSP中使用JDBC连接MySQL数据库的详细步骤

    本文主要介绍了JSP中使用JDBC连接MySQL数据库的详细步骤,对于初学者具有很好的参考价值,需要的朋友一起来看下吧

    Java连接数据库和断开数据库讲解 代码.rar

    Java连接数据库和断开数据库讲解 代码,研究JDBC连接SQLServer数据库,很简单但很实用的例子,从建立驱动连接到打开数据库的过程,欢迎学习参考。主要代码如下:  Class.forName(...

    使用JDBC的高级数据库操作

    本教程旨在向您介绍几种高级数据库操作, 包括存储过程和高级数据类型,它们可以通过使用 JDBC 的 ...我们推荐您先完成使用 JDBC 管理数据库连接这一教程。 其中的链接参考资料包括关于 JDBC 的补充信息的参考。

Global site tag (gtag.js) - Google Analytics